Navigating the Clean Energy Transition: Challenges, Innovations, and the Role of Hydrogen
Key Ideas
  • Europe is accelerating its transition to clean energy to achieve energy security and independence, aiming for 42.5% clean energy in the overall mix by 2030.
  • Rapidly rising power demand, driven by technologies like AI and data centers, calls for flexible and innovative energy strategies to reduce emissions.
  • Gas turbine power plants, evolving to be hydrogen-ready, present a promising opportunity for decarbonization and emission reduction in the energy sector.
  • Hydrogen has the potential to play a crucial role in the energy transition by enhancing flexibility in power and grid systems, but it requires significant investment and regulatory support to scale efficiently.
The global energy sector is facing vulnerabilities, driving the need for clean energy solutions. Europe's geopolitical challenges have expedited the transition to cleaner power sources, with a target of 42.5% clean energy by 2030. The rise in power demand, fueled by emerging technologies, poses challenges to existing grid infrastructure. Gas turbine power plants, when adapted for a low-carbon future and integrated with hydrogen, offer a viable option for emission reduction. However, to succeed in decarbonization, hydrogen needs substantial investment and supportive policies to scale effectively. Various geographies still rely on natural gas, emphasizing the importance of evolving gas turbines to reduce emissions and maintain reliability. Hydrogen's applications can enhance grid flexibility, but clear regulatory frameworks and incentives are crucial for its development. Germany's strategy exemplifies the shift towards hydrogen and gas in energy transition, aiming for zero carbon emissions in industries by 2045.
